Deadline to apply for financial support: April 30, 2010 http://www.ma1.upc.edu/recerca/seminaris/JISD2010/indexjisd2010.html ------ Subject: Research Meeting on Stochastic Delay Differential Equations From: "Neville Ford" Date: Tue, 30 Mar 2010 14:22:41 +0100 Research Meeting on Stochastic Delay Differential Equations at University of Chester, UK Title: Numerical and analytical solution of stochastic delay differential equations, 31st August -3rd September 2010. To be held at the Department of Mathematics, University of Chester, Parkgate Road, Chester CH1 4BJ, UK Organised by the Leverhulme Research Network whose members include: Neville Ford - University of Chester, UK Uwe Kuchler - Humboldt University at Berlin, Germany John Appleby - Dublin City University, Ireland Xuerong Mao - University of Strathclyde, UK Christopher Baker - Universities of Chester & Manchester, UK Leonid Shaikhet - Donetsk State University of Management, Ukraine Alexander Matasov - Lomonosov Moscow State University, Moscow Michael Tretyakov - University of Leicester, UK Speakers already confirmed include: Gabriel Lord - Heriot-Watt University Bernt Oksendal - University of Oslo, Norway Gennady Bochorov - Institute of Numerical Mathematics, Russian Academy of Sciences Leonid Shaikhet - Donetsk State University of Management Xuerong Mao - University of Strathclyde Sotirios Sabanis - The University of Edinburgh Chenggui Yuan - University of Wales, Swansea Full details are available at the meeting homepage: http://www.stochasticdelay.org.uk/ The Leverhulme International network, based in Chester and led by Professor Neville Ford, has been established for 3 years, from 2008 to 2011, with the aim of bringing together experts from the areas of mathematical modelling, mathematical analysis, numerical and computational methods and stochastic analysis of functional differential equations. This is the 3rd of 4 network workshop meetings to enable methodologies to be shared and new working methods and collaborations to be established.
